Increasing Tennessee Highway Patrol Presence in Memphis

Memphis, Tenn. has recently seen a notable shift in its public safety landscape as Governor Bill Lee announces an increase in the number of Tennessee Highway Patrol (THP) troopers stationed in Shelby County. With crime rates on the rise, especially in urban areas, the governorโ€™s strategic move aims to bolster security and enhance community safety.

Tripling the Trooper Count

In the past few years, the number of troopers in the Shelby County district has remarkably tripled. Currently, there are 44 troopers actively serving in this area, and just around the corner, the governor has plans to boost this number even further. โ€œWe expect to have 10 more troopers after the next cadet class. That will be 54 troopers,โ€ Lee stated, expressing his commitment to making the roads safer for all residents and travelers.

A Response to Rising Crime

This initiative is not just about numbers; it is genuinely a response to the growing concerns over public safety. City leaders in Memphis had requested additional THP manpower back in 2022, motivated by a troubling surge in interstate shootings which raised alarms across the community. Local authorities believe that a heightened presence of state troopers on the roads can deter criminal activities as well as ensure that the overall atmosphere feels more secure.
